Two Looms, One Box

Most beginner weaving kits include a single loom. This gift box includes two - each producing different types of woven pieces and teaching complementary skills.

  • Bookmark loom (6.8cm × 20.8cm, FSC and PEFC certified birch plywood): produces long, narrow woven strips - bookmarks, bag handle ties, decorative bands. Quick to set up, satisfying to complete in a single session.
  • Square frame loom (11cm × 11cm, FSC and PEFC certified birch plywood): produces small square woven patches - coasters, fabric swatches, appliqué patches, greetings card inserts, small wall art pieces. A different shape, a different scale, and a new set of creative possibilities.

Both looms are reusable and can be used again with any DK yarn once the included yarn is finished.

What You will Learn

The instruction booklet covers three core weaving patterns, introduced step by step:

  • Tabby (plain weave)  the foundation of all weaving, where warp and weft threads alternate in a simple over-under sequence
  • Twill  the diagonal interlacement structure used in denim and herringbone fabric
  • Houndstooth  the classic two-colour geometric check pattern

These three patterns are the building blocks of almost all hand-woven fabric and provide a solid foundation for any weaving journey that follows.
